Cardamom prices rose by Rs 9.50 to Rs 724.40 per kg in futures trade today as speculators created fresh positions amid a rise in spot market demand against restricted arrivals.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, cardamom for delivery in November rose by Rs 9.50, or 1.32%, to Rs 724.40 per kg in business turnover of 321 lots.
Similarly, the spice for delivery in December traded higher by Rs 2.40, or 0.32%, to Rs 751 per kg with a trade volume of 58 lots.
Marketmen said fresh positions created by speculators, driven by a rise in demand in the spot market against limited arrivals from producing belts mainly led to rise in cardamom prices at futures trade.
